Gender Recognition Act 2004 Explanatory Notes

Section 6: Errors in certificates

22.This makes provision for the correction of a gender recognition certificate. The application for correction may be made by either the person to whom the certificate was issued or the Secretary of State. It must go to either the Panel or the court, depending on who issued the certificate. An application for a correction will be granted and a corrected certificate issued if the Panel or court is satisfied that the certificate contains an error.
